使用以下调用时间创建的值何时会超时?
后续的增量调用是否更新了到期日期?
MemcacheService cacheService;
cacheService.increment(key, delta, initialValue);
答案 0 :(得分:3)
Memcache是LRU中指向的documentation缓存。
如果您未设置实验,则行为如下:
默认情况下,只要保留存储在memcache中的值 可能。当新值出现时,可以从缓存中逐出值 如果缓存内存不足,则添加到缓存中。当值是 由于记忆压力而被驱逐,最近最少使用的值是 首先被驱逐。
如果您设置了到期日期:
该价值将在不迟于此时被驱逐,尽管可能如此 因其他原因被驱逐。